  • Description

    The mechanism of action of Cyanocobalamin, a synthetic form of vitamin B12, involves its role as a cofactor in various enzymatic reactions. It primarily supports the normal functioning of the nervous system and the formation of red blood cells. Cyanocobalamin aids in the synthesis of DNA, RNA, and myelin, which is essential for maintaining the integrity of the nervous system. Additionally, it contributes to the metabolism of fatty acids and amino acids, ensuring proper energy production and cellular function. Pyridoxine, also known as vitamin B6, serves as a coenzyme in numerous metabolic processes. It plays a crucial role in the metabolism of amino acids, particularly in the synthesis of neurotransmitters such as serotonin, dopamine, and g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A). Pyridoxine is involved in the conversion of tryptophan to niacin, the release of glucose from glycogen, and the synthesis of hemoglobin. Together, these components in the tablet formulation support various physiological functions and contribute to overall health.

  • In case of Overdose

    In the case of an overdose of Cyanocobalamin and Pyridoxine, the symptoms may include sensory changes, numbness, tingling, muscle weakness, and difficulty walking. In severe cases, it can lead to difficulty breathing, rapid heart rate, and even loss of consciousness. Prompt medical attention is necessary to manage these symptoms, which may require hospitalization and supportive care to ensure the patient's safety and well-being. Immediate medical intervention is vital to prevent potential long-term complications.

  • Drug Interactions

    Following are the drug interactions for Cyanocobalamin, Pyridoxine [100 mg/3ml] Tablet:

    • Alcohol consumption may decrease the absorption of Cyanocobalamin, reducing its effectiveness.
    • Pyridoxine can decrease the effect of levodopa (used in Parkinson's disease) and phenytoin (an anticonvulsant).
    • Concomitant use of chloramphenicol (an antibiotic) may reduce the response to Cyanocobalamin.
    • Antacids containing aluminum may decrease the absorption of Cyanocobalamin.
    • Pyridoxine may interact with drugs like hydralazine, reducing its blood pressure-lowering effect.
    • Drugs that lower blood pressure, such as ACE inhibitors or beta-blockers, may have an enhanced effect when taken with Pyridoxine.
    • Certain medications used for treating depression, such as tricyclic antidepressants, may interact with both Cyanocobalamin and Pyridoxine.

  • Storage/Disposal

    Cyanocobalamin and Pyridoxine Tablets should be stored in a cool, dry place, preferably at room temperature between 68-77°F (20-25°C). Protect the tablets from excessive heat, moisture, and direct sunlight, ensuring they are kept in their original container with the cap tightly closed. It is crucial to maintain a secure storage location, out of the reach of children and pets. Do not use the medication after the expiration date printed on the packaging. When disposing of unused or expired tablets, do not throw them into the trash or flush them down the toilet. Instead, follow local guidelines or consult a pharmacist or healthcare professional for safe disposal practices to minimize environmental impact.
